CVE-2025-45611
CVE-2025-45611
Weakness (CWE)
CVSS Vector
v3.1- Attack Vector
- Network
- Attack Complexity
- Low
- Privileges Required
- None
- User Interaction
- None
- Scope
- Unchanged
- Confidentiality
- High
- Integrity
- High
- Availability
- High
Description
Incorrect access control in the /user/edit/ component of hope-boot v1.0.0 allows attackers to bypass authentication via a crafted GET request.
Comprehensive Technical Analysis of CVE-2025-45611
1. Vulnerability Assessment and Severity Evaluation
CVE ID: CVE-2025-45611
Description: The vulnerability involves incorrect access control in the /user/edit/ component of hope-boot version 1.0.0. This flaw allows attackers to bypass authentication mechanisms via a crafted GET request, potentially leading to unauthorized access and manipulation of user data.
CVSS Score: 9.8
Severity Evaluation:
- Critical: A CVSS score of 9.8 indicates a critical vulnerability. The high score is likely due to the ease of exploitation, the potential for significant impact, and the lack of required user interaction.
- Impact Metrics: The vulnerability can result in complete loss of confidentiality, integrity, and availability of the affected system.
- Exploitability Metrics: The attack vector is network-based, and the complexity is low, meaning it can be exploited remotely with minimal effort.
2. Potential Attack Vectors and Exploitation Methods
Attack Vectors:
- Network-Based Attack: An attacker can exploit this vulnerability remotely by sending a specially crafted GET request to the
/user/edit/endpoint. - Authentication Bypass: The primary attack vector involves bypassing the authentication mechanism, allowing unauthorized access to user data.
Exploitation Methods:
- Crafted GET Request: An attacker can craft a GET request that mimics an authenticated user's request, thereby gaining unauthorized access to edit user information.
- Automated Scripts: Attackers may use automated scripts to scan for vulnerable endpoints and exploit them en masse.
3. Affected Systems and Software Versions
Affected Software:
- hope-boot v1.0.0: The vulnerability specifically affects version 1.0.0 of the
hope-bootsoftware.
Affected Systems:
- Web Applications: Any web application utilizing
hope-bootversion 1.0.0 is at risk. - Servers: Servers hosting the vulnerable version of
hope-bootare potential targets.
4. Recommended Mitigation Strategies
Immediate Actions:
- Patch Management: Apply the latest patches or updates provided by the software vendor. If a patch is not available, consider upgrading to a newer version if it addresses the vulnerability.
- Access Controls: Implement additional access controls and authentication mechanisms to mitigate the risk of unauthorized access.
- Network Segmentation: Segment the network to limit the exposure of vulnerable systems.
Long-Term Strategies:
- Regular Audits: Conduct regular security audits and vulnerability assessments to identify and address similar issues.
- Code Review: Implement a robust code review process to catch and fix access control issues during the development phase.
- Security Training: Provide security training for developers to ensure they are aware of common vulnerabilities and best practices for secure coding.
5. Impact on Cybersecurity Landscape
Broader Implications:
- Increased Risk: The presence of such a critical vulnerability highlights the ongoing risk of authentication bypass issues in web applications.
- Attacker Opportunity: Attackers may leverage this vulnerability to gain unauthorized access to sensitive user data, leading to potential data breaches and loss of user trust.
- Industry Response: The cybersecurity community and software vendors must prioritize secure coding practices and thorough testing to prevent similar vulnerabilities in the future.
6. Technical Details for Security Professionals
Technical Analysis:
- Vulnerable Component: The
/user/edit/endpoint inhope-bootv1.0.0 lacks proper access control mechanisms, allowing unauthenticated users to perform actions reserved for authenticated users. - Exploit Detection: Security professionals can detect exploitation attempts by monitoring for unusual GET requests to the
/user/edit/endpoint. - Log Analysis: Review server logs for unauthorized access attempts and unusual patterns in GET requests.
- Intrusion Detection Systems (IDS): Configure IDS to detect and alert on suspicious GET requests targeting the
/user/edit/endpoint.
Mitigation Steps:
- Implement Multi-Factor Authentication (MFA): Enhance security by requiring MFA for accessing sensitive endpoints.
- Web Application Firewalls (WAF): Deploy WAFs to filter and block malicious GET requests.
- Regular Patching: Ensure that all software components are regularly updated and patched to address known vulnerabilities.
Conclusion: CVE-2025-45611 represents a critical vulnerability that underscores the importance of robust access control mechanisms in web applications. Immediate mitigation strategies, including patching and enhanced access controls, are essential to protect against potential exploitation. Long-term, the cybersecurity community must continue to emphasize secure coding practices and thorough vulnerability assessments to prevent similar issues.